Castor’s Moving Backgrounds finally gives one of the Midwest’s great underground secrets the expansive vinyl treatment it deserves. Gathering the band’s complete recorded output for the first time on wax, this 2025 collection shines a long-overdue spotlight on a group that quietly carved its own path through the fertile Champaign-Urbana scene of the 1990s.

Emerging alongside influential peers like Hum and Braid, Castor never settled into a single lane. Their 1995 self-titled debut explored patient, experimental slow-core textures, while 1997’s Tracking Sounds Alone pushed toward a dreamier, post-shoegaze sound filled with layered guitars and atmospheric depth. Across both albums, the band balanced introspection with ambition, creating music that felt equally suited for headphones and dimly lit clubs.

This 2LP set features a newly remastered version of Castor alongside a reimagined remix of Tracking Sounds Alone by vocalist and guitarist Jeff Garber. Standout songs from both eras reveal a band fascinated by mood, space, and subtle emotional shifts, with shimmering guitars and thoughtful arrangements that anticipated many of the sounds indie rock would embrace in the years that followed. Five bonus tracks further deepen the story, offering an even fuller picture of Castor’s creative evolution.

Pressed on orange and clear 180-gram vinyl, Moving Backgrounds also includes new artwork by Andy Mueller, original album jackets, and extensive liner notes. It is a beautifully assembled archival release that celebrates a band whose influence quietly echoes far beyond its brief original run.
